Masari Warns APC NWC Against Inducement of Aspirants

Aminu Masari, a Katsina-born politician and former Speaker of the House of Representatives, issued a warning to the All Progressives Congress (APC) National Working Committee (NWC) regarding the potential inducement of aspirants seeking party tickets for upcoming elections. Speaking at the APC National Secretariat, Masari emphasized the importance of resisting temptations that could undermine the party's integrity and urged the NWC, led by Yilwada, to act in the best interests of the party and the nation.
He highlighted the imminent local government primaries and expressed a desire for divine guidance to ensure the committee successfully navigates the challenges ahead. Masari commended the APC National Chairman and the former Speaker's team for conducting a seamless convention, describing it as one of the most organized and transparent events ever held in Nigeria.
